Brief Summary

Nonsurgical root canal retreatment may become essential when the initial endodontic treatment fails because of the persistent intracanal or extracanal infections.The aim of this thesis study is to evaluate the effect of ProTaper Universal Retreatment (PTUR), Reciproc blue and XP-endo Finisher R file systems, which are used in the removal of root canal filling materials during retreatment with different motion kinetics on the release of Substance P, Calcitonin Gene-Related Peptide (CGRP), IL-6 and IL-10 inflammatory mediators in the periapical region

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(1)

  • change of inflammatory mediator level

    The samples were collected from periapical exudate at the end of the root canal retreatment procedure. The samples were analyzed with ELISA method and change of inflammatory mediator levels were evaluated in pg/ml.

    24 hours

Study Arms (3)

Retreatment system using in rotational motion

EXPERIMENTAL

Previous root canal filling materials were removed with D1-D2-D3 retreatment files with using an endodontic motor in rotational motion

Other: Protaper Universal Retreatment

Retreatment system using in reciprocal motion

EXPERIMENTAL

Previous root canal filling materials were removed with Reciproc 25 file with using an endodontic motor in reciprocal motion

Other: Reciproc

Retreatment system using in additional rotational motion

EXPERIMENTAL

Previous root canal filling materials were removed with XP-endo finisher r file with using an endodontic motor in rotational motion

Other: XP-Endo finisher R

Interventions

D1-D2-D3 Retreatment files were used in 500 rpm and 3 Ncm with X-Smart endomotor

Retreatment system using in rotational motion

R25 retratment files were used with X-Smart endomotor in reciprocal motion

Retreatment system using in reciprocal motion

XP-Endo finisher r file were used in 1000 rpm 1 Ncm with X-Smart endomotor

Retreatment system using in additional rotational motion
